Why Sweet Pea Seeds Are the Best Cut Flower Seeds
-
Unmatched Fragrance: Sweet peas fill your garden and arrangements with a delightful scent.
-
Long, Elegant Stems: Perfect for cutting and arranging in bouquets.
-
Continuous Blooms: With proper care, sweet peas provide flowers all season long.
-
Versatile Filler: Their ruffled petals and trailing vines add texture and movement to any bouquet.

How to Grow Sweet Peas for Cut Flowers
Sweet peas thrive in cool weather and love full sun. For the best results:
-
Sow seeds early in spring or late fall in mild climates.
-
Provide support like trellises or netting for long, straight stems.
-
Harvest regularly to encourage more blooms and longer vase life.

FAQ: Cut Flower Seeds, Flower Seeds & Sweet Pea Seeds
Q: What are the best cut flower seeds for bouquets?
A: Sweet pea seeds are among the top choices for cut flowers due to their fragrance, long stems, and continuous blooms. Other great options include zinnias, cosmos, and sunflowers.
Q: How do I grow sweet peas for cut flowers?
A: Plant sweet pea seeds early in the season, provide sturdy support, and harvest blooms regularly to encourage more flowers all season.

Q: Are sweet peas easy to grow from seed?
A: Yes! Sweet peas are easy to start from seed and thrive with cool weather, sun, and support.
Q: Can sweet peas be grown in containers?
A: Absolutely. Sweet peas do well in containers as long as they have support and regular watering.

Q: Do sweet peas attract pollinators?
A: Yes, sweet peas attract bees and other pollinators, making them a great addition to pollinator-friendly gardens.
